Can I upload historical content, writings by dead folks, raw footage of news events, etc?

Where does the community/platform stand on these uses of the Library?

Since mid-2016 my main social media has been the HIVE blockchain, where original content is a pretty big focus, and it is definitely a faux pas to post other people's content without declining rewards, crediting them, etc.

Since discovering yesterday that the platform can be used to upload ebooks and the like as well, I'm VERY interested in exploring those uses! I have literally thousands of books on the occult, permaculture, philosophy, medicine, mathematics, survival, architecture, and much, much more. Many of these are very old, one-off printings, and other hard-to-find texts. I would love to be able to share all of this with the world through this platform if possible, since then I can simply send links to people, I don't have to have access to my full drive (many terabytes) in order to give someone a particular document, etc.

If this is something that's considered acceptable on the platform, I'm going to create a different channel(s) for this process, rather than filling my personal channel with tons of other peoples' work.
